Komatsu revolutionizes manufacturing with Microsoft Azure and AI
Komatsu, a leading Japanese manufacturer of heavy equipment, has harnessed the power of Microsoft Azure to optimize its manufacturing process. Initially rolling out its IoT system, KOM-MICS, in 2014, the company aimed at collecting data from machine tools and welding robots to perform predictive maintenance. The migration to Microsoft Azure in 2017 enabled Komatsu to scale its operations internationally, ensure better disaster recovery systems, and operate seamlessly in earthquake-prone regions. Recently, Komatsu has integrated AI solutions powered by Intelligent Edge, helping automate maintenance prediction and improving operational efficiency.
